Skin information?
Hi all
I'm doing a little study about skins (generic, not just Winamp specific). Could anyone help me out, please? I would very much appreciate any pointers to the origins of the skin culture. I'm looking for things like where and when was skinning "born"? What was the first program that got skinned? Was it an option of the program itself or just a result of clever hacking? the first skinned mp3 player was yamp (Yet Another Music Player) from germany
the first skinned winamps were indeed hacked, the bmp files inside of winamp.exe were replaced with borland recource workshop or renovator, www.fli7e.de has some skins with bitmaps from the first hacks i don't know if other apps were skinable before yamp check www.customize.org and www.deviantart.com for skins for a variety of programs |

Way back in the day, people started hacking games and replacing textures. This was happening way back in the Doom era, although I'm not sure if that was pre-Yamp.
